Twins | Jorge Polanco due back Monday
Minnesota Twins SS Jorge Polanco is expected to return to the team when he is first eligible to be reinstated from his 80-game suspension Monday, July 2.  Source: St. Paul Pioneer Press - Mike Berardino
 
BHQ take: Fantasy owners will be eager to see the 2018 debut of Polanco, who hit .256 in 2017 but added double-digits in HR and SB (13 for each category). He finished 2017 as the Twins' No. 3 hitter, posting a .316 BA since Aug. 1. He went 8-for-19 in six rehab games in getting ready for Monday's return.
